NTC thermistors are temperature sensors based on the principle that electrical resistance of a thermistor changes with temperature. In operation, an NTC thermistor’s resistance decreases as the temperature increases. It also exhibits a negative temperature coefficient, meaning that resistance goes down as temperature goes up. Since it is a type of thermistor, it is sensitive to the heat energy around it and changes its resistance according to the temperature.
